The Hawkeye Rolex Owner: Unveiling Laura Barton's Hidden Past

Before *Hawkeye*, Laura Barton was largely an enigma. We knew she was a supportive wife and mother, but her own background remained shrouded in mystery. The Rolex watch, however, provides a strong suggestion that her past is far more intriguing than previously imagined. The watch itself is not just any timepiece; it's a symbol of wealth, sophistication, and, importantly, potential access to privileged circles. The type of Rolex, though not explicitly identified in the show, is clearly a high-end model, hinting at a connection to a world of influence and resources.

This, combined with the subtle hints of Laura's fighting prowess demonstrated in the finale (her quick and efficient takedown of several Tracksuit Mafia members), strongly suggests a history of training and experience beyond the life of a typical suburban housewife. The implication is clear: Laura Barton is not who she initially appears to be. The Rolex becomes a visual representation of her hidden capabilities and a potential link to her past.

Hawkeye Wife Shield Agent: Connecting the Dots

The most prominent theory, and one supported by many viewers, is that Laura Barton was a highly trained Shield agent, potentially working alongside or even under Clint Barton during his Ronin days. Her proficiency in combat, coupled with the Rolex – a watch that would not be out of place among high-ranking Shield operatives – strongly supports this theory. The Rolex could be a memento of her time with Shield, a tangible reminder of a past life she now chooses to keep hidden from her family.
